How much do front desk sales j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for front desk sales in the United States is $14.71,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.74 and $16.11 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a front desk sales representative do?

A front desk sales representative greets customers, provides information about products or services, and assists with sales transactions. They often handle customer inquiries, maintain the reception area, and use point-of-sale systems to process purchases, requiring good communication and customer service skills.

What is the difference between Front Desk Sales vs Customer Service Representative?

AspectFront Desk SalesCustomer Service Representative
CredentialsBasic sales and communication skills, sometimes sales certificationsCustomer service training, communication skills
Work EnvironmentReception area, retail, hospitality, healthcareCall centers, retail, corporate offices
Employer & Industry UsageHotels, gyms, car dealerships, clinicsTelecom, retail, tech companies
Primary FocusPromoting sales, greeting clients, handling inquiriesResolving customer issues, providing information

While both roles involve communication and customer interaction, Front Desk Sales emphasizes promoting products or services and generating sales at the reception or front desk. Customer Service Representatives focus on assisting customers, resolving issues, and maintaining satisfaction. The roles often overlap but differ mainly in their primary objectives and sales involvement.

What are front desk sales?

Front desk sales refer to the responsibilities of employees who manage the reception area while also handling sales-related tasks, such as selling products or services, booking appointments, and processing payments. These professionals are often the first point of contact for customers, providing information about offerings, promoting memberships or specials, and ensuring a positive customer experience. The role typically requires strong communication skills, a customer-oriented attitude, and the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
